On Wed, Jun 06, 2001 at 07:01:58PM +0200, Vojtech Pavlik wrote:
> On Wed, Jun 06, 2001 at 12:31:28PM -0400, Jeff Garzik wrote:
> > hmmm. I just looked over this, and drivers/char/joystick/ser*.[ch].
> >
> > Bad trend.
> >
> > Serial needs to be treated just like parport: the basic hardware code,
> > then on top of that, a selection of drivers, all peers: dumb serial
> > port, serial mouse, joystick, etc.
>
> Agreed. Completely.
I suggest that if someone is thinking about this that they look at
serial_core.c in the ARM patch hunk.
(ftp.arm.linux.org.uk/pub/armlinux/source/kernel-patches/v2.4/)
Note that you shouldn't apply the whole patch - it probably won't compile
for anything but ARM atm.
